Fascinating Vintage Photographs Documented A “Spirit Of Christmas” In The 1895–1930s


A woman returns home from the market with a Christmas tree. (Photo by Otto Haeckel/Getty Images). 1895


A Christmas tree in an Edwardian parlour. (Photo by Hulton Archive/Getty Images). Circa 1905


At Christmas toy hawkers, like this one on Ludgate Hill and Holborn, thronged the streets of London.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 1913


New York’s Christmas tree for the homeless waiting to be erected in Madison Square.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 27th December 1913


A Christmas advertising scheme at Watling Street, London.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 20th December 1913


Christmas entertainments at the Hospital for Sick Children in Great Ormond Street, London.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 30th December 1913


A soldier carrying a christmas tree.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). December 1915


Father Christmas reading with three young children. (Photo by Spencer Arnold/Getty Images). Circa 1915


Children carrying holly and mistletoe.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). December 1915


Christmas trees being delivered for the members of the American army staying at the Palace Hotel in London. (Photo by J. J. Lambe/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). December 1918


A young sailor buys a Christmas tree at a greengrocer’s and a young boy waits in a queue of children to buy some mistletoe. (Photo by A. R. Coster/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 24th December 1918


A family sitting down for tea at Christmas time.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 21st December 1919


Two little boys dragging home their Christmas tree after choosing it at London’s Covent Garden Market. (Photo by Keystone/Getty Images). Circa 1920


The interior of a tube train decorated with foliage for the Christmas Season.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). Circa 1922


Three girls on Christmas morning delighted with their gifts from Father Christmas. (Photo by Basset Lawke/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 15th December 1925


A crowd of happy youngsters chase Father Christmas along a London street. He is on his way to a south London store to distribute presents. (Photo by H. F. Davis/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 2nd November 1926


Children from the Royal Caledonian School enjoying a festive Christmas pageant on an open top bus which is carrying Santa and his helpers through the streets. (Photo by Fox Photos/Getty Images). December 1926


Christmas carol singers in a London suburb.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 1927


Boys of Ardingly School at the start of the Christmas holidays. (Photo by Fox Photos/Getty Images). 1926


A little girl taking home her Christmas Tree, bought from Caledonian Road Market, London.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images). 1929
